Building a Custom ASP.NET Membership Provider
The Provider model allows you to splice your own code into what would normally be a system path by creating a custom class and wiring up the config file. Membership is a concept that tracks users and passwords. The SQL Membership Provider stores all the user and password information in database tables; there’s no option for using SQL Server Logins. Jeff will build a basic SQL Login Membership Provider that allows users to log in, and even generates a connection string with their credentials.
